What Are Electric Ovens and Hobs?

Electric ovens are kitchen devices developed for baking, broiling, roasting, and other cooking techniques that require regulated heat. They make use of electric coils or convected heat elements to generate and preserve the wanted temperature level. Electric hobs, typically described as electric cooktops, are flat surfaces with heating aspects that permit pots and pans to be positioned directly on them for cooking.

Advantages of Electric Ovens and Hobs

When thinking about electric ovens and hobs, it’s vital to understand their various benefits, which can boost the cooking experience.

1. Consistent Heating

Electric ovens and hobs provide even and consistent heating, which is important for many cooking strategies. This guarantees that meals prepare evenly, decreasing the chances of overcooking or undercooking specific locations of food.

2. Security Features

Modern electric ovens and hobs come geared up with various safety functions to avoid mishaps in the kitchen. For instance, many designs consist of automatic shut-off functions, hot surface area indications, and kid safety locks.

3. Easy to Use

Unlike gas designs, electric ovens and hobs are simple and easy to use. The simpleness of switching on a dial or pressing a button makes them accessible for cooks of all ability levels.

4. Versatile Cooking Options

With different cooking approaches possible, from baking to simmering, electric designs are versatile enough to accommodate a wide variety of culinary designs and preferences.

5. Cleaning and Maintenance

Electric ovens usually feature smooth surfaces that are easy to tidy, especially models with self-cleaning capabilities. Hobs, especially induction types, likewise offer a flat surface that is easy to wipe down, making maintenance a breeze.

Popular Types of Electric Hobs:

  • Induction Hobs: Utilize magnetic fields for quick heating and energy effectiveness.
  • Radiant Hobs: Feature electric coils that warm up to cook food.
  • Ceramic Hobs: Offer a smooth surface area and are easy to clean.

Considerations When Choosing Electric Ovens and Hobs

While electric ovens and hobs offer numerous benefits, numerous aspects ought to be considered to guarantee the right suitable for your kitchen:

1. Space Availability

Assess the readily available kitchen space before buying. Identify whether you require a built-in model or a freestanding appliance, and measure the dimensions carefully to make sure a good fit.

2. Cooking Needs

Determine your cooking routines and preferences. If you regularly bake big amounts or cook complex meals, consider an oven with advanced functions like convection settings or numerous racks.

3. Energy Efficiency

Try to find energy-efficient designs that can assist conserve on utility bills in time. Energy Star-rated devices can be particularly affordable.

4. Spending plan

Set a realistic budget plan that represents both the initial purchase and ongoing operating costs. In addition to the appliance expense, aspect in installation and possible repairs.

5. Additional Features

Consider whether features like wise innovation, programmable settings, or steam cooking alternatives are very important for your cooking style.

FAQ Section

Q: How do I clean my electric oven?

A: Most electric ovens sale included self-cleaning alternatives. If your model does not have this feature, permit the oven to cool, then wipe down surface areas with a mix of baking soda and water or an industrial oven cleaner.

Q: Is induction cooking safe?

A: Yes, induction cooking is considered safe as the heating aspect only activates when compatible cookware is in contact with it, reducing the danger of burns.

Q: How long does it consider an electric oven to pre-heat?

A: Preheating times differ based on the oven’s model and temperature level setting however generally range from 10 to 15 minutes.

Q: Can I utilize any cookware on an induction hob?

A: No, just ferromagnetic pots and pans works with induction hobs. Look for sale oven induction compatibility before usage to prevent damage.

Q: What is the distinction between a convection oven and a traditional electric oven?

A: A convection oven includes a fan that flows hot air, making sure even cooking and decreased cooking times compared to a standard electric oven, which does not have this function.
